The Mighty East Campbelltown Eagles would like to welcome Richard Barnes as the Sydney Shield Coach for 2015, Barnzy the coach of the Eagles 2012 Undefeated Claytons Cup Premiership winning team, first started with the Eagles in 2007 and since this time has helped fill the Eagles Trophy Cabinet, the Eagles Record under Barnzy's Guidance is as follows :
2007 Kiama 9-aside Runners Up
2007 Canterbury 1st Grade Premiers
2009 Cabramatta 9 aside plate winners
2010 Group 6 Preseason Premiers
2011 Group 6 Preseason Premiers
2011 Group 6 Runners Up
2012 Kiama 9-aside Runners Up
2012 Group 6 Undefeated Premiers
2012 Claytons Cup Winners

It's with great pleasure that we see the return of one of the finest coaches in the Macarthur District to the Mighty Eagles for 2015
